Output 8fcff16ea85e5b6318a83fc900b01a5ff7af2b520e67e2b1140fc6450549bfbe:0

value
819707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 403358220c64eab664787a6542d263318fcad0c7 OP_EQUAL
address
37YUgHPEvj2Vv6a591VgDDa87kduaq4h5D
transaction
8fcff16ea85e5b6318a83fc900b01a5ff7af2b520e67e2b1140fc6450549bfbe
confirmations
171325
spent
true